Aim:
make the Broadcom4306 wireless card work on a Ferrari3400(AMD
x64)running Gutsy.

Description:
- when pressing the wireless button on the laptop the correct wireless
network show up in gnome-network-manager but the icon still shows an
orange exclamation mark
- when running pppoeconf it can not find any network on eth1, which
should be the right one
- wired network works fine even though the exclamation mark in the
gnome-network-manager is still present...sometimes the exclamation mark
disappear though  (?_?)

Troubleshooting attempts:
- tried with the restricted driver (System>Administration>Restricted
Drivers Manager) without luck.
- tried fwcutter suggested by
https://help.ubuntu.com/community/HardwareSupportComponentsWirelessNetworkCardsBroadcom which I installed, but after rebooting it still did not working. (Perhaps there are other steps I did not do though?)
- have tried earlier with this script
http://ubuntuforums.org/showthread.php?t=405990 but that screwed up the
whole network manager.
